For most of its 50-year history, the Pell Grant has not covered summer classes, with two brief exceptions: 2009-2011 and 2017 to the present. The findings are consistent with research showing that continuous enrollment improves persistence and completion. Liu found clear advantages for the students who got summer money.

Justin Ortagus, an associate professor of higher education administration and policy and the director of the Institute of Higher Education at the University of Florida, examined over 40,000 student transcripts from a diverse, high-enrollment community college from between 2009 and 2019.

Indeed, during the 2008-2009 recession, giving fell along with the economy, and it took three years for philanthropy to start growing again. On the other hand, our research showed that the remarkable revenue increases seen by 72% of our partner institutions in FY’21 resulted in part from fundraisers persisting in their proposal submissions.

AAUA is a non-profit professional organization founded in 1970 for higher education leaders and administrative personnel.
